摘要:

目的 探讨移动医患交互平台在心脏瓣膜置换术围手术期患者吸气肌训练(inspiratory muscle training,IMT)中的应用效果。方法 采用便利抽样法,选取2023年8月—2024年6月于浙江省某三级甲等医院心脏大血管外科行心脏瓣膜置换术的患者124例为研究对象,采用随机数字表法分为试验组和对照组,试验组患者采用联合医患交互平台的IMT,对照组采用常规呼吸功能锻炼。比较两组患者在出院时及出院1个月门诊复查时的衰弱水平、心肺功能、肺部并发症等指标。结果 最终纳入研究对象122例,试验组和对照组各脱落1例。试验组患者在出院1个月后的衰弱水平、心肺功能和肺部并发症发生率均优于对照组,差异有统计学意义(P<0.05),并且衰弱评分、握力、5次坐立试验、肺功能指标等存在交互效应(P<0.05)。结论 基于移动医患交互平台的IMT能改善心脏瓣膜置换术后的心肺功能,逆转衰弱状态,降低术后并发症发生率,为术后居家康复的延续护理提供实践路径。

关键词: 吸气肌训练, 心脏瓣膜置换术, 衰弱, 心肺功能, 康复

Abstract:

Objective To explore the efficacy of a mobile patient-physician interactive platform for perioperative inspiratory muscle training(IMT) in patients undergoing heart valve replacement. Methods Using the convenient sampling method,a total of 124 patients who underwent cardiac valve replacement in the cardiovascular surgery department of a tertiary grade A hospital in Zhejiang Province from August 2023 to June 2024 were selected by convenience sampling and randomly divided into an experimental group and a control group using a random number table. The experimental group received IMT combined with a mobile patient-physician interaction platform,while the control group received conventional respiratory function exercise. Cardiopulmonary function indicators,frailty levels,cardiopulmonary function and postoperative pulmonary complications were compared between the two groups at discharge and during the one-month follow-up outpatient visit. Results A total of 122 patients were collected in this study,and one dropout each in the experimental and control groups. Patients who received mobile platform-based IMT showed significantly better frailty levels,cardiopulmonary function,and postoperative pulmonary complications at the one-month follow-up compared to the control group(P<0.05). Additionally,interaction effects were observed in frailty score,grip strength,Five-Times Sit-to-Stand Test(FTSTS) and pulmonary function indicators(P<0.05). Conclusion IMT delivered via a mobile patient-physician interaction platform improves cardiopulmonary function,reverses frailty,and reduces postoperative pulmonary complication rates in patients following heart valve replacement,offering a novel practical pathway for continuity of care during home-based rehabilitation.

Key words: Inspiratory Muscle Training, Cardiac Valve Replacement, Frailty, Cardiopulmonary Function, Rehabilitation
